About the role

Key responsibilities & impact
  • Design and defend the network security architecture across data centers, corp, and cloud: segmentation, firewalls, and east-west controls at gigawatt scale.
  • Build network detection: telemetry, flow analysis, and alerting across training fabrics, OT networks, and the WAN.
  • Harden the OT and BMS side, where the network touches physical plant, against threats most security teams never see.
  • Automate network security controls so new sites inherit the architecture on day one.

Requirements

What you’ll need
  • You've secured production networks at scale, and you read a packet capture as comfortably as a dashboard.
  • You've designed segmentation for environments that mix IT, OT, and high-value compute.
  • You've deployed and tuned NDR or flow-based detection that found real intrusions.
  • You work infrastructure-as-code: your firewall rules live in a repo, not a GUI.
  • You've partnered with network engineering without becoming the department of no.
  • Bonus: OT and ICS security. Data center or cloud provider environments. BGP and routing security. Zeek or Suricata.
